To direct the Attorney General to reimburse State and local law enforcement agencies for costs incurred in carrying out law enforcement activities associated with the armed occupation of the Malheur National Wildlife Refuge, and for other purposes.

What it doesSummary introduced in house (Feb 2, 2016)
This bill directs the Department of Justice (DOJ) to reimburse state and local law enforcement agencies for costs associated with the armed occupation of the Malheur National Wildlife Refuge in Harney County, Oregon.
DOJ may file a civil action against an armed occupation participant to recover reimbursement costs.
